Eat a vegan diet once a week. On days I work out I usually opt for a vegan diet. Eating only plants and grains for a day makes digestion easier and gives your body a lighter feeling during workouts. Here are some suggestions. Try one or all of them:
Breakfast: your favorite energy bar, coffee or tea
Lunch: hummus wrap
Before workout snack: fruit smoothie
After workout snack: apple slices with almond or peanut butter
Extra tip: Stay hydrated! Drink 6-8 glasses of water a day and carry a water bottle.
